case when 中计数如何去重

利用DISTINCT,但是需要使用COUNT(column) 而不是SUM(1)

SELECT count(DISTINCT  case is_not_exit when true then enterprise_id end)  from table_a

 

posted on 2020-09-20 10:55  我欲皆真  阅读(1639)  评论(0编辑  收藏  举报

导航